What is One Page Investment Proposal Template?
One Page Investment Proposal Template is a document that provides a concise overview of an investment opportunity. It condenses all the essential information into a single page, making it easy for potential investors to understand the proposed project quickly. This template acts as a powerful tool for entrepreneurs and companies to present their business ideas and attract funding.
What are the types of One Page Investment Proposal Template?
There are several types of One Page Investment Proposal Templates available, each designed to cater to specific industries or investment purposes. Some common types include:
Startup Investment Proposal Template: Tailored for startups seeking funding to launch their business ideas.
Real Estate Investment Proposal Template: Geared towards real estate developers and investors looking to fund property projects.
Technology Investment Proposal Template: Designed for tech companies or innovators seeking capital for research, development, or product launches.
Social Impact Investment Proposal Template: Created for organizations or initiatives with a focus on making a positive social or environmental impact.
Expansion Investment Proposal Template: Aimed at established businesses looking to expand their operations or enter new markets.
How to complete One Page Investment Proposal Template
Completing a One Page Investment Proposal Template requires thoughtful planning and attention to detail. Here are some steps to help you:
01
Start with a compelling executive summary that highlights the key points of your investment opportunity.
02
Provide a clear and concise description of your business or project, including its purpose, target market, and value proposition.
03
Outline your revenue model and financial projections to demonstrate the potential return on investment.
04
Include information about your team and their expertise, showcasing their abilities to execute the project successfully.
05
Highlight any competitive advantages or unique selling points that set your proposal apart from others in the market.
06
Address potential risks and mitigation strategies to show that you have considered potential challenges thoroughly.
07
End with a strong call-to-action, inviting investors to further discuss the opportunity with you.
